Output c22389929d8f7e81bb2fe89f00a18ef2e100c76f070b98c0a5c935d8efcd51cc:2

value
38500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2f8797da21525bc34b05cdd1beb9fcd285cd223 OP_EQUAL
address
3KTvg5J7Wjv4hngT5Eqz7uMSjPPWiBTxmj
transaction
c22389929d8f7e81bb2fe89f00a18ef2e100c76f070b98c0a5c935d8efcd51cc
confirmations
311886
spent
true